Learning Map

Purpose:
1. Save time
2. Get more things done
3. Save space
4. Find what we are looking for easily


Advantage (Comparing with traditional notes):
1. More structured and logically built up
2. More fun and well organized
3. Can make use of our creative thinking and imagination


Procedure:
1. Write or draw the central word/idea in the middle of a blank piece of paper
2. Start making free associations to that central point. Let branches and twigs grow out of the centre and write one word on each line
3. When getting too many words around the central word, or if associations suddenly come to an end, just open new ‘forks’ after one of the existing words.
**Remember to create as more abundant/diversified as possible.
4. After 5-10minutes, looking at all the words and pick out a few that would like to try on another map. Either put them in the middle of a new map or just go on writing new associations where the word is in the first map.
**Going more and more into detail in the associations.
**Write down every word that pops into mind.
5. Let the map rest for a while. The thinking process and the flow of associations will go on in our brains even if we stop writing and when we come back to the map we will have a lot of new words to add.
6. Let the map stay unstructured until you feel it is maturity.


Rules:
1. Start in the middle of the paper.
It is easier to spread out the lines that way and to read what you have written.
2. One word on each line.
If you need more words, draw new lines. Try to limit the number of words you write. You need only a few words if you choose the right words (keywords).
3. Use different colours.
Use colours to highlight, to decorate, to differentiate one group of words from another and in illustrations.
4. Draw pictures.
Pictures contain a lot more information than words. Try to find pictures that can gather information from a whole group of words.
5. Use symbols, signs and arrows.
Use symbols, signs and arrows to show connections in your learning map or if you want to refer to other reference material you don’t want to have in the learning map. E.g. **, --> , #, +
6. Use your imagination.
Nothing is really forbidden in your own learning map. A learning map is a personal note-taking technique and whatever increases your use of it is permitted.
7. Rewrite the learning map.
Every time you rewrite the learning map you revise the material and you get rid of words you already know, words that are superfluous in one way or another.

諧音法Homonymic Method

諧音法Homonymic Method


Homonymic method is about the word, number and thing which use others similar words to replace or substitute. The following table is the example of number.


number 數字諧音例字
0 零、陵、林、靈、麟、令
1 衣、醫、邑、已、意、椅
2 兒、耳、而、爾、珥、異
3 山、杉、散、珊、扇、婆
4 似、司、私、師、絲、材
5 吳、午、市、烏、物、我
6 劉、留、流、瘤、柳、老
7 奇、齊、氣、乞、企、漆
8 巴、叭、琶、把、鈸、化
9 糾、酒、就、舅、鳩、腳




How to use this table??
03 --> 靈山
54064 --> 我是你老師


Example:
1. To remember Pi or π ( 3.141592653589793238462643383279)
3.14159 265 358979 3238462643 383279
山顛一寺 一壺酒, 爾留我, 三胡把酒吃酒; 三兒三爸死留兒, 留四傘, 三爸三兒吃酒


2. To remember telephone number
For example: 8204 0102 --> 百事寧死 靈幽靈異



Conclusion:
You can use homonymic method to apply with another method such as story method.The first step is creating the similar words to replace the specific things. Then, using the story method, you can use these words to create a story.

省略法 Acronyms

省略法 Acronyms

An Acronym is a word formed from the first or first few letters of several words. For example, HKSAR is an Acronym for Hong Kong Special Administrative Region. Sometimes, people will make all of the words to be a simple sentence or even a song.

Extended Acronyms is one of the popular forms of Acronym -when a sentence or verse is created from the first letter of each word to help us remember certain pieces of information in sequence.

By applying the acronyms, people can remember more products names or features. Let’s practice more! The following is the example.

Example 1: “Roy G. Biv”
It is the order of the spectrum, in order from left to right.
Red, Orange, Yellow, Green, Blue, Indigo and Violet

Example 2: Remember the China provinces
These four sentences can include all China Provinces from Mr. Zhou, En Lai (周恩來).

兩湖兩廣兩河山
五江雲貴福吉安
四西兩寧青甘陝
還有內台北上天

1. 兩湖兩廣兩河山
兩湖﹕湖南、湖北
兩廣﹕廣東、廣西
兩河山﹕河南、河北、山東、山西

2. 五江雲貴福吉安
五江﹕江蘇、浙江、江西、黑龍江、新疆(「疆」的國語同「江」相同)
雲﹕雲南 貴﹕貴州 福﹕福建
吉﹕吉林 安﹕安徽

3. 四西兩寧青甘陝
四﹕四川 西﹕西藏
兩寧﹕寧夏、遼寧
青﹕青島 甘﹕甘肅 陝﹕陝西

4. 還有內台北上天
內﹕內蒙古 台﹕台灣
北﹕北京 上﹕上海 天﹕天津

The Story Method

The Story Method is one of the techniques for memorizing many things. Use a story as the link to remember a set of words or sequence of activities. When we were small, we heard a lot of bedtime stories, like Snow White, Three Little Pigs, etc. Up till now, we can still remember the details of the story. Hence, we find it is a good way to memorize things. “Make the story vivid and easy to remember, with silly things happening and with strong sensory content.” The story can be silly and unreasonable. Just like sometimes we can remember almost all of the “broken gags” we have heard but cannot remember the theories we have learnt from the academic subjects.
(Ref: http://changingminds.org/techniques/memory/story.htm, retrieved on 2/3/2009)

The following is the suggestion:
有一個人的肚子很餓,於是他去買甘蔗吃,忽然聞到一陣香水味,他就說︰「好香啊﹗」因為甘蔗是冰的,他吃了覺得很冷,所以穿上外套,吃完了甘蔗,覺得餐後潔牙很重要,所以趕快用牙刷刷牙,刷完牙後,踩到一顆雞蛋,蛋黃流出來,害他滑了一跤,撞到了一棵,他抬頭一看,樹上都是神奇寶貝的貼紙,他想起等一下將上演神奇寶貝,於是急急忙忙回家看電視,趕路趕得太累了,覺得很口渴,拿起杯子想裝水喝,一不小心把杯子摔到地上弄破了,只好趕緊拿掃把把碎片掃起來。

Is the story silly? Yes, it is. But it can help us to remember things more. In addition, if the story is full of exaggeration (誇張), it also helps us to memorize the items better!
